Warning Signs You Need Stucco Water Damage Repair
Ignoring these signs can lead to more costly problems down the line. Don’t risk it, address the issue now, and save yourself the headache later. Here are some warning signs you need stucco water damage repair: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, especially after a storm or heavy rainfall, it may be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Buckling or Blistering Stucco
Inspect your stucco regularly for signs of buckling or blistering. This can be a sign of water intrusion and needs to be addressed ASAP. Don’t let it spread contact us today for a consultation.
Discoloration or Staining
Keep an eye out for discoloration or staining on your stucco exterior. This can be a sign of water damage and needs to be addressed quickly. We’ll get to the root of the problem and fix it for you.
Water Staining on Ceilings or Walls
Water staining on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a more serious issue. Don’t ignore it, address the issue now to prevent further damage. We’ll get your home dry and stable in no time.
Peeling or Flaking Stucco
Inspect your stucco regularly for signs of peeling or flaking. This can be a sign of water damage and needs to be addressed quickly. We’ll get to the root of the problem and fix it for you.
Water Damage on Exterior Trim or Flashing
Water damage on exterior trim or flashing can be a sign of a more serious issue. Don’t ignore it, address the issue now to prevent further damage. We’ll get your home’s exterior back in shape in no time.
Stucco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age on a small area (less than 10 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Y-friendly, but ensure you follow proper drying and repair procedures. |
| Water damage on a large area (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are required to ensure a thorough and efficient repair. |
| Water damage on a roof or exterior wall | No | Yes | Roof and exterior wall repairs need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a safe and effective repair. |
| Water damage on stucco with structural integrity issues | No | Yes | Structural integrity issues need profess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Water damage on stucco with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need professional attention to remove and prevent further growth. |

Common Questions About Stucco Water Damage Repair
Q: What causes stucco water damage?
A: Stucco water damage occurs when water penetrates the stucco exterior, causing damage to the underlying structure. This can be due to various factors, including weather, poor construction, or maintenance issues. We’ll identify the root cause and fix it for you.
Q: How long does stucco water damage repair take?
A: The duration of stucco water damage repair dep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and complexity of the repair. Typical repair times range from 3-5 days, but this can v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ll work efficiently to get your home back in shape.
Q: Is stucco water damage repair covered by insurance?
A: Yes, stucco water damage repair may be covered by your homeowners insurance policy. But, coverage and deductibles vary depending on your policy and provider. We’ll help you navigate the process and ensure you get the coverage you deserve.
Q: Can I prevent stucco water damage?
A: Yes, stucco water damage can be prevented with regular maintenance and inspections. Keep an eye out for signs of water damage, and address any issues quickly. We’ll help you stay on top of maintenance and repairs.
